Course Details
• Public Advocacy Fundamentals: Understanding the role of public advocacy, differentiating it from other forms of advocacy, and identifying key stakeholders.
• Strategic Communication Planning: Developing a communication strategy that effectively conveys the message, including audience analysis and messaging tactics.
• Media Relations and Engagement: Building relationships with media representatives, creating press releases, and managing interviews.
• Digital Advocacy: Utilizing social media, email campaigns, and other digital tools to reach and engage a wider audience.
• Grassroots Organizing: Mobilizing community members, building coalitions, and creating a network of supporters.
• Policy Analysis and Research: Analyzing and interpreting policy documents, identifying potential areas for improvement, and conducting research to support advocacy efforts.
• Lobbying and Government Relations: Understanding the legislative process, building relationships with elected officials, and advocating for policy change.
• Fundraising and Resource Development: Developing a fundraising strategy, identifying potential donors, and securing financial support for advocacy efforts.
• Ethics and Best Practices: Understanding the ethical considerations and best practices in public advocacy, including transparency, accountability, and cultural sensitivity.
